JOE WILES: Number 4 on our top 80 most downloaded guitar tabs on the Internet is "Fade to Black" by Metallica. Let's take a look. Now we're going to start with the index finger of our left hand on the 2nd fret of the A string, then our ring finger on the 4th fret of the D string. We're going to hit those two in a row, then the open G string. Okay? It sounds like this. And then come back down. Okay? One, two, three, four, five. Hit the D string again. Bring your pinkie up to the 5th fret of the A string and then hit them again. Okay? It sounds like this. The next bar, you just open up the A string, keeping your ring finger on the 4th fret of the D string. Do the same motion. Pinkie back up to the 5th fret and then go back to the original. Then we're going to switch it up on a chord. We're going to take our ring finger and put it on the 4th fret of the A string, and then we're going to take the pad of our index finger and put it and lay it across the 2nd frets of the G and the B strings. We're going to give that the same motion, then open up your A string, then D string. All together, slowly, it sounds like this. In our next segment, we're going to take a look at number 3.
